Advanced Diagnostic Capabilities
Precise diagnosis represents the foundation of successful pain management. Denver Pain Management Clinic uses state-of-the-art diagnostic tools to pinpoint the specific source of a patient's pain.

Comprehensive physical examinations allow the pain doctors to evaluate movement patterns and identify areas of sensitivity that may suggest root issues. This physical approach provides valuable information that guides treatment decisions.

Advanced imaging technologies such as CT scans offer clear visualizations of structural issues that may be causing pain. These technologies enable the pain doctors to identify issues that aren't visible through surface examination alone.

Targeted diagnostic procedures such as nerve blocks can help in confirming suspected diagnoses by momentarily stopping pain signals from certain nerves. The reaction to these interventions provides crucial information about the origin and type of the pain.

Multidisciplinary Treatment Approaches
The pain doctors at Denver Pain Management Clinic believe in a multidisciplinary approach to pain management, utilizing different treatment methods to achieve best results for each patient.

Minimally invasive pain management techniques involve precise injections such as epidural steroid injections that provide medication directly to the location of pain. These treatments can offer substantial relief for many pain conditions while avoiding the side effects associated with oral medications.

Medication management functions as an important role in various pain management plans. The pain doctors carefully choose and monitor medications to guarantee effective pain relief while reducing risks and negative outcomes. This measured approach focuses on both safety and effectiveness.

Exercise therapy programs developed by experienced therapists help patients regain function and minimize pain through targeted exercises and stretches. These plans are personalized to each patient's unique needs and abilities.

Integrative therapies such as biofeedback may be incorporated into treatment plans to provide additional pain relief through natural means. These methods enhance standard medical treatments to treat pain from different angles.
